Blockchain

Binary Fields and SNARKs: Discovering Cryptographic Efficiency

.Rebeca Moen.Sep 25, 2024 05:04.This article examines the role of binary fields in SNARKs, highlighting their efficiency in cryptographic operations and possible future advancements.
Binary industries have actually long been a foundation in cryptography, delivering effective operations for electronic units. Their importance has actually developed along with the growth of SNARKs (Succinct Non-Interactive Arguments of Understanding), which make use of areas for complicated estimations as well as evidence. Depending on to taiko.mirror.xyz, recent trends pay attention to reducing the industry size in SNARKs to improve effectiveness, using constructs like Mersenne Best areas.Comprehending Fields in Cryptography.In cryptography, industries are algebraic constructs that permit fundamental arithmetic procedures-- addition, reduction, reproduction, as well as department-- within a set of numbers, adhering to specific guidelines like commutativity, associativity, and also the life of neutral aspects and inverses. The easiest field made use of in cryptography is actually GF( 2) or F2, consisting of just two components: 0 as well as 1.The Significance of Area.Specialization are actually crucial for doing calculation operations that create cryptographic tricks. While boundless areas are actually feasible, personal computers run within limited industries for productivity, commonly making use of 2 ^ 64-bit areas. Much smaller industries are actually liked for their reliable math, straightening along with our mental versions that prefer controllable parts of records.The SNARKs Landscape.SNARKs verify the formality of complicated computations with low resources, making all of them perfect for resource-constrained environments. There are actually 2 main types of SNARKs:.Elliptic Curve Based: Understood for exceptionally little verifications as well as constant-time verification yet might require a depended on configuration and also are actually slower to produce proofs.Hash-Based (STARKs): Rely on hash functions for safety and security, possess larger proofs, and are slower to verify but faster to prove.SNARKs Performance Challenges.Functionality bottlenecks in SNARK procedures commonly arise during the course of the commitment period, which entails generating a cryptographic dedication to the witness information. Binius addresses this issue making use of binary areas as well as arithmetization-friendly hash functionalities like Grostl, although it presents brand-new obstacles in the disappearing argument stage.SNARKs Over the Smallest Field.The existing fad in cryptographic research is to minimize area sizes to reduce embedding overhead. Projects like Cycle STARKs and Starkware's Stwo prover currently make use of Mersenne Best fields for better central processing unit marketing. This technique straightens with the organic individual possibility to operate on smaller, a lot more effective fields.Binary Fields in Cryptography.Binary ranges, represented as F( 2 ^ n), are finite ranges along with 2 ^ n features. They are essential in digital systems for encrypting, handling, and also broadcasting records. Building SNARKs over binary fields is an unique approach introduced through Irreducible, leveraging the simplicity and also performance of binary calculation.Developing a High Rise of Binary Fields.Starting with the most basic binary area F2, much larger areas are built through offering new elements, forming a tower of areas: F2, F2 ^ 2, F2 ^ 4, and so forth. This construct permits effective arithmetic functions across different area dimensions, stabilizing protection requires along with computational productivity in cryptographic uses.Potential of Binary Area.Binary industries have actually been important to cryptography for a long time, yet their application in structure SNARKs is actually a recent and also encouraging growth. As study progresses, binary field-based evidence methods are actually counted on to observe significant improvements, straightening with the fundamental individual inclination in the direction of simpleness and efficiency.Image resource: Shutterstock.

Articles You Can Be Interested In